Who said : " Foolish enough to build MRT"? .by Ryo Miyaichi on Monday, August 22, 2011 at 8:19am.Who said: "FOOLISH ENOUGH to build MRT"? On the one hand, we had President Ong Teng Cheong (then Minister of Communication): "The MRT is much more than a transport investment, and must be viewed in its wider economic perspective. The boost it'll provide to long term investors' confidence, the multiplier effect and how MRT will lead to the enhancement of the intrinsic value of Singapore's real estate are spin-offs that cannot be ignored." - 28 March 1982 "The MRT will usher in a new phase in Singapore's development and bring about a better life for all of us." On the other hand, we had a "visionary" Minister who went out of his way to deliberately, publicly, and rudely slam President Ong - the chief advocate for the MRT system - as being "FOOLISH ENOUGH": "The construction industry has become over-heated and if Singapore were to be foolish enough to want to build its proposed mass rapid transit (MRT) system now, it will find itself in trouble." - Forum on economic affairs at NUS, 17 December 1981.
